FEATURES - Downconverter - Conversion loss - 9 d B typical for 24 GHz to 29 GHz - 11 d B typical for 29 GHz to 38 GHz - LO to RF isolation - 40 d B typical for 24 GHz to 29 GHz - 38 d B typical for 29 GHz to 38 GHz - LO to IF isolation - 27 d B typical for 24 GHz to 29 GHz - 44 d B typical for 29 GHz to 38 GHz - RF to IF isolation - 20 d B typical for 24 GHz to 29 GHz - 28 d B typical for 29 GHz to 38 GHz - Input IP3 - 18 d Bm typical for 24 GHz to 29 GHz - 19 d Bm typical for 29 GHz to 38 GHz (downconverter) - IF frequency: dc to 18 GHz - Passive, no dc bias required APPLICATIONS - Point to point radios - Point to multipoint radios and very small aperture terminal (VSAT) radios - Test equipment and sensors - Military end use FUNCTIONAL BLOCK DIAGRAM Figure 1. GENERAL DESCRIPTION The HMC560A chip is a gallium arsenide (Ga As), monolithic microwave integrated circuit (MMIC), double balanced mixer that can be used as an upconverter or downconverter from 24 GHz to 38 GHz in a small chip area.
